Mr. Poirier brings nearly two decades of capital markets experience in the natural resource and technology sectors. He has served in various senior officer and corporate development roles at exploration mining companies. From September 2016 through December 2019 Mr. Poirier was CEO of Bearing Lithium Corp. and was instrumental in the Company's acquisition of Li3 Energy. Prior to Bearing Lithium, Mr. Poirier held senior roles at Pure Energy Minerals Ltd. and is currently the CEO of Hilo Mining Ltd.
Joel Leonard is the founding Partner of JCL Partners Chartered Professional Accountants located in Vancouver. Joel has developed an extensive background in finance and accounting with a focus on financial reporting and internal control implementation. Joel completed his Bachelor's Degree in Business from Thompson Rivers University and later received his CPA designation with the Chartered Professional Accountants of British Columbia. Joel has spent the past five years consulting for publicly traded entities listed on various exchanges including the NYSE, TSX, TSX-V and the CSE. Joel has held the position of Chief Financial Officer for a number of publicly listed entities throughout his career including: Stillcanna Inc., Pike Mountain Minerals Inc., and FenixOro Gold Corp. (Formerly First Divisions Minerals Inc.).
Mr. Doulis has more than 20 years of experience in the metals and mining sector including investment banking, corporate finance, mergers and acquisitions and business development. Most recently, Mr. Doulis was CEO of Buchans Wileys Exploration, a private Canadian exploration company, active in the Buchans region of Western Newfoundland. With a strong focus on due dilligence, he was also a senior mining analyst/partner at Stonecap Securities and a senior analyst at PI Financial. Mr. Doulis was also a partner at Gryphon Partners, a boutique advisory services firm focused on the mining industry. Mr. Doulis received his BA in Economics from Queen's University and earned his CFA designation in 2000.

Mr. Taddei brings seventeen years of experience as a senior executive in the mineral resource industry, culminating in twelve years as the Chief Financial Officer of MAG Silver Corp. where he was instrumental in its growth. His relationships extend to the investment community, playing a lead role in defining capital structure and balance sheet management. He was responsible for all aspects of MAG's financial operations, including treasury, taxation, IT systems, insurance, and risk management. He also played a key role in the company's governance and ESG guidelines, policies, and procedures. Prior to MAG, Mr. Taddei was Chief Financial Officer of West Timmins Mining Inc. until its purchase by a producing major in 2009 for CAD $ 424 million after the discovery of the Thunder Creek gold deposit. Mr. Taddei is a Chartered Professional Accountant with the Chartered Professional Accountants of British Columbia and an Accredited Director with the Chartered Governance Institute of Canada. He holds a Bachelor of Commerce Degree from the University of British Columbia.

The issuer's main focus is an on-going exploration of its 5,000 square kilometre Lithium-Cesium-Tantalum and Rare Earth Element Finnish Pegmatite Project, in central and southern Finland. The company's concessions are located within 11 miles of the Keliber under construction which is expected to begin production in H2 2025. The Finland Pegmatite Project consists of ten exploration concessions in central and Northern Finland and one exploration concession in southern Finland. These reservations cover a total area of over 5,000 square kilometres and are focused on Lithium-Cesium-Tantalum or LCT pegmatite complexes located within the Jarvi-Pohjanmaa and Seinajoki lithium-permissive tracts as defined by the Geological Survey of Finland (GTK). Four of the reservations (Nabba, Lappajarvi West, Lappajarvi East and Kaatiala) lie immediately adjacent to, and to the south of, Keliber Oy's spodumene mine development project in the Kaustinen district.
The Company currently has no producing properties. The Company leases its head Office.
